• Funeral services for Jacob R. Diller, 91, were held Thursday morning, Sept. 13, at the Hesston Mennonite Church with Rev. Richard Yordy officiating. Mr. Diller died Sept. 11 at Schowalter VilIa where he had been a resident since 1962. A native of Markham, Ont., he came to Kansas in 1913 and was baptized in the Hesston Mennonite Church in 1914. He and his wife, the former Grace Cooprider, lived on a farm near Hesston for many years and he engaged in farming and carpentry. He built many homes in the Hesston community. Mrs. Diller died in 1972. Surviving are five sons, John, Allen, Robert, Ivan and Eugene, and one daughter, Mrs. Lois Hershberger, all of Hesston; 18 grandchildren and six great-granddaughters.
